What's the best time of year to travel to East Wenatchee with my pet?
When you’re traveling with pets, keeping track of the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 67°F, while the coldest months are December and January with an average of 31°F. The snowiest months in East Wenatchee are January, December, February, and March, with each month seeing an average of 5 inches of snowf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in East Wenatchee?
Known for its sports, East Wenatchee has lots to offer visitors including its riverfront and hiking trails. See the local sights and visit Lincoln Rock State Park and Wenatchee River. While you’re there, make sure you don’t miss Columbia River and Highlander Golf Course.
